I know it from my own experiments, dmt fumarates are very poorly soluble, if at all, in dry IPA at room temperature. Also thats why it works to recrystallize dmt fumarates with IPA, you have to get it hot to dissolve DMT.. and thats also why dissolving dmt freebase in IPA and adding FASI will make fumarates precipitate, if they were soluble in IPA they wouldnt precipitate. If your IPA had significant water content and/or if your 'room temperature' is high, it might somehow dissolve a bit.
